casual Game is a structured activity, usually undertaken for enjoyment and sometimes used as an educational tool. casual Games are distinct from work, which is usually carried out for remuneration, and from art, which is more concerned with the expression of ideas. However, the distinction is not clear-cut, and many casual games are also considered to be work (such as professional players of spectator sports/casual games) or art (such as jigsaw puzzles or casual games involving an artistic layout such as Mahjong solitaire).

Key components of casual games are goals, rules, challenge, and interaction. casual Games generally involve mental or physical stimulation, and often both. Many casual games help develop practical skills, serve as a form of exercise, or otherwise perform an educational, simulational or psychological role. According to Chris Crawford, the requirement for player interaction puts activities such as jigsaw puzzles and solitaire "casual games" into the category of puzzles rather than casual games.
